About Orville Wright Engineering and Design Magnet

Orville Wright Engineering and Design Magnet operates as a modestly sized 6-8 campus in Los Angeles, California, overseen by Los Angeles Unified. Current enrollment sits at 456 students spanning grades 6 through 8. By comparison, California's public schools average about 659 students each, so Orville Wright Engineering and Design Magnet sits 31% smaller than that benchmark.

Orville Wright Engineering and Design Magnet is one of 784 schools operated by Los Angeles Unified, a district that works with 406,887 students overall.

Demographically, Orville Wright Engineering and Design Magnet shows that the largest single group is Black, at 61% of enrollment. The remainder reads as 29% Hispanic, 5% multiracial, 3% White. By comparison, Los Angeles County as a whole is about 8% Black, so the school skews visibly more Black than its surroundings.

Looking at the economic backdrop, The school employs 26 full-time-equivalent teachers, for a student-teacher ratio near 17.4:1. That figure is tighter than the state norm's 20.7:1 average. An estimated 82% of students are eligible for free or reduced-price lunch, a number frequently used as a low-income enrollment indicator. That share is noticeably above Los Angeles County's rate of about 70%.

Across the wider county, census data for Los Angeles County shows median household income runs about $90,112, 36%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and the poverty rate sits near 10%. In all, Los Angeles County runs 2244 public schools (combined enrollment of about 1,265,907 students), of which Orville Wright Engineering and Design Magnet is one.

Nearest neighbor: WISH Community, around 0.1 miles off. 8 of the 8 nearest public schools sit inside a five-mile radius.

Orville Wright Engineering and Design Magnet operates from a city-core location.

Over the past 7-year window. Over the past 7-year window, the student count ticked down 28%: 637 students in 2018 compared to 456 in 2025. The student-to-teacher ratio tightened from 21.6:1 in 2018 to 17.4:1 today.
